AAP's central war room to keep tab on political pulse in Delhi's 7 LS seats

The Aam Aadmi Party (AAP) on Friday inaugurated its Central Control War Room at its headquarters here, consisting of 20 members core team.

The central war room is said to be connected to seven war rooms located across all Lok Sabha constituencies in the city-state.

AAP's Delhi unit convenor Gopal Rai told ANI that the Central War Room will function as the nerve centre for the Lok Sabha elections and will remain connected 24x7 with seven other war rooms across Delhi.

The core team includes members from different units, who have to provide daily feedback from their units and collate reports on their unit's performance.

''The foremost task of the team at the Central office is to ensure that we have daily progress reports from all seven constituencies. This work is monitored round the clock by a 20-member core team," he said.

Senior party volunteer Suresh Kathait is said to be in charge of the internal party coordination and communication unit.

The important units of the control war comprise media, social media, technical support, frontal organisations reporting, relevant Election Commission permissions, manifesto preparation, daily research issues, daily reports from observers in all 70 constituencies, and exposing lies of opponents.

''AAP has appointed coordinators from the Central War Room in each Lok Sabha constituency. These seven coordinators will communicate with 10 observers,'' said Rai.

Rai also delivered a live demonstration of the Central Control War Room which showed how the core team connects and coordinates with the field teams, the mode, and signals for communication and feedback.
